Work Package 2: Multi-infections


The work-package 2 will focus on mechanisms and epidemiology of multi-infections. Multi-infections are the rule but this context is not still completely taken into account in the management of infectious diseases.
Thus, the first challenge will be to decipher the molecular and cellular mechanisms governing interactions between infectious agents. This will enable us to understand the synergistic or antagonistic effects of their relationships, or the dynamics of resistance emergence in a multi-parasitic context.

Two major research topics:
 
► To understand viral and/or bacterial co-infections at the molecular and cellular levels

► To identify synergistic and antagonistic interactions between infectious agents in natural conditions


These interactions will be studied in environments of variable complexity and particularly at the hospital, an intermediate environment between natural conditions and highly controlled laboratory conditions.
